How Invisalign Aligners Work
The process starts with a consultation where your dentist creates a custom treatment plan. Using 3D imaging technology, your aligners are designed to gradually shift your teeth into their proper position. Here’s how it works:
- Wear each set of aligners for about two weeks.
- Remove them only to eat, drink, brush, and floss.
- Visit your dentist periodically to monitor progress and receive new aligners.
Over time, the aligners gently move your teeth into alignment, providing noticeable results without the discomfort of wires or the hassle of frequent adjustments.
Who Can Benefit from Invisalign
Invisalign is suitable for a wide range of patients, including teens and adults. It can address various dental issues, such as:
- Crowded teeth
- Gaps between teeth
- Overbites, underbites, and crossbites
However, not everyone is a candidate. Severe alignment issues might require other orthodontic treatments. A consultation with a local dentist specializing in Invisalign or even dental implants in Mississauga can help determine if this is the right choice for you.

Maintaining Your Invisalign Aligners
Cleaning and Storing Aligners Properly
Keeping your Invisalign aligners clean is essential—not just for their durability but also for your oral health. A clean aligner means a healthier smile. Here’s how to make sure they stay in top shape:
- Rinse them regularly: Always use lukewarm water before putting them back in. Avoid hot water, as it can distort the plastic.
- Brush them gently: Use a soft-bristled toothbrush and clear, non-abrasive soap to clean them. Toothpaste can scratch the surface, so skip it.
- Soak them daily: Use aligner cleaning crystals or tablets. Just drop one into a glass of water and let your aligners soak for 15-20 minutes.
- Store safely: When not wearing them, put your aligners in their protective case. This prevents loss and keeps them hygienic.
Tips for Wearing Aligners Consistently
Consistency is the key to success with Invisalign. Here are a few tips to help you stick to the routine:
- Wear them for 20-22 hours daily: This is non-negotiable if you want your treatment to stay on track.
- Set reminders: Use alarms or phone apps to remind yourself to put them back in after meals.
- Plan: If you’re heading out, bring your aligner case and a small cleaning kit with you.
- Avoid eating or drinking (except water): Food and colored drinks can stain or damage your aligners.
It’s not just about wearing them; it’s about making them a part of your daily routine. Small habits lead to big results.
Ensuring Long-Term Results
Once your Invisalign treatment is complete, maintaining that perfect smile requires some effort. Here’s how to ensure the results last:
- Wear your retainer: After treatment, your dentist will likely recommend a retainer to keep your teeth in place.
- Schedule regular check-ups: Continue visiting your dentist to monitor your smile’s health and alignment.
- Stick to good oral hygiene: Brush and floss daily to keep your teeth and gums healthy.
- Avoid harmful habits: Chewing on pens, ice, or nails can shift your teeth over time.
Taking care of your aligners and following these practices ensures that your Invisalign journey leads to a smile you’ll love for years to come.

Cost and Payment Options in Mississauga
Thinking about Invisalign? It’s good to know what you’re signing up for financially. In Mississauga, the cost of Invisalign treatments typically ranges between $3,500 and $8,000, depending on the complexity of your case. Most dental clinics offer flexible payment plans to make the process easier. Here’s how you can manage the costs:
- Insurance Coverage: Check if your dental insurance includes orthodontic treatments. Many plans cover part of the cost.
- Monthly Payment Plans: Clinics often provide interest-free installment options.
- Health Spending Accounts (HSAs): If you have an HSA, you can allocate funds toward your Invisalign treatment.
